SB 510 by Sen. Charles Perry - Relating to the transfer of certain state property from the Texas Department of Criminal Justice to Stephens County. TDCJ will transfer 288.8 acres from the Walker Sayle Unit to Stephens County. In an effort to address these staffing shortages, this item proposes a 10% unit differential pay increase for correctional staff working on these maximum security facilities. Correctional Officer and Parole Officer Career Ladder Restructure/Pay Raise. Adopted by Conference Committee - $84.1 million. SUMMARY Correctional: Allows for a career ladder restructuring. Reduces the time frame for maximum salary to 7 years, with a 3.7% increase to the current maximum salary.
